Contrary to what you may think, just about anything can result in asthma. The more common triggers of it include allergies, an upper respiratory infection, stress, over exertion in exercise, or even the lack of a proper diet.

Out of all the triggers, allergies tends to be the most common. In most cases, asthma attacks are the result of exposure to things such as smoke, pollen, gas odors, and even automotive exhaust.

Foods can also trigger attacks as well, such as peanuts, corn, chocolate, and almost all dairy products. If you take any type of antibiotics, tranquilizers, or hormones, it may prompt asthma.
